@roadraccoon4715
@roadraccoon4715 Ай бұрын
If you haven’t left yet….Beware of your REI quilt. That’s the same one I used on the divide last year. After 15-20 nights, the down in the horizontal chambers sloughed off to the sides and left me freezing until I got it replaced. Every night I would shake it back to the middle, to no use. I do toss&turn a lot , but it still seemed to me that there was not enough filling. Mine was a 30 degree.
@RonSuchanek
@RonSuchanek Ай бұрын
Thanks for the heads up. I've had this one for a few years and so far haven't had that problem. sounds miserable! My wife bought an Enlightened Equipment quilt after I bought mine and she loves it.
